A mind-body workbook for healing and overcoming Complex PTSD

Those affected by complex PTSD, or C-PTSD, commonly feel as though there is something fundamentally wrong with them—that somewhere inside there is a part of them that needs to be fixed. Facing one's PTSD is a brave, courageous act—and with the right guidance, recovery is possible.

In The Complex PTSD Workbook, you'll learn all about C-PTSD and gain valuable insight into the types of symptoms associated with unresolved childhood trauma. Take healing into your own hands while applying strategies to help integrate positive beliefs and behaviors.

Discover your path to recovery with:
  • Examples and exercises—Uncover your own instances of trauma with PTSD activities designed to teach you positive strategies.
  • Expert guidance—Explore common PTSD diagnoses and common methods of PTSD therapy including somatic therapy, CBT, and mind-body perspectives.
  • Prompts and reflections—Apply the strategies you've learned and identify PTSD symptoms with insightful writing prompts.

Find the tools you need to work through C-PTSD and regain emotional control with this mind-body workbook.

About the Author

Arielle Schwartz, PhD, is a licensed clinical psychologist, EMDR therapy consultant, certified Clinical Trauma Professional, and author. She earned her doctorate in Clinical Psychology at Fielding Graduate University and her master’s degree in Somatic Psychology from Naropa University. She lives and runs a private practice in Boulder, Colorado.
